Hola, tengo el wp 4.2.3 instalado y al activar el plugin WPML (2.7.1) me aparece la página de wp-admin en blanco. ¿Qué puedo hacer para corregir esto?
URL del sitio: Contenido solo visible a usuarios registrados
Hola
Si te aparece una página en blanco revisa los errores recientes que se generan en el archivo /wp-admin/error_log
Podrías también pasar la herramienta Stephan, disponible desde tu área de cliente.
Saludos
He revisado uno a uno los plugins compatibles con WPML y me causa el error con el plugin Gantry Template Framework. ¿Qué puedo hacer?
En /wp-admin/error_log me aparece este error:
[03-Aug-2015 19:21:02 Europe/Berlin] PHP Warning: PHP Startup: Unable to load dynamic library '/usr/local/lib/php/extensions/no-debug-non-zts-20090626/timezonedb.so' - /usr/local/lib/php/extensions/no-debug-non-zts-20090626/timezonedb.so: cannot open shared object file: No such file or directory in Unknown on line 0
¡Hola Nagore!
Por lo que comentas todo apunta a que el plugin de traducción es incompatible con otros plugins de tu sitio Wordpress.
Te recomendamos usar QTranslateX:
- Multiidiomas en WordPress con qTranslated X - Instalacion y Configuracion - https://www.webempresa.com/blog/item/1823-multiidiomas-en-wordpress-con-qtranslated-x-instalacion-y-configuracion.html
- Migrando las traducciones de qTranslate y mqTranslate a qTranslate X - https://www.webempresa.com/blog/item/1746-migrando-las-traducciones-de-qtranslate-y-mqtranslate-a-qtranslate-x.html
- Multiidiomas en WordPress con qTranslated X - Conmutador de Idiomas - https://www.webempresa.com/blog/item/1824-multiidiomas-en-wordpress-con-qtranslated-x-conmutador-de-idiomas.html
- Multiidiomas en WordPress con qTranslated X - Traduciendo post y entradas - https://www.webempresa.com/blog/item/1827-multiidiomas-en-wordpress-con-qtranslated-x-traduciendo-post-y-entradas.html
- Multiidiomas en WordPress con qTranslate X - Traduciendo Widgets - https://www.webempresa.com/blog/item/1830-multiidiomas-en-wordpress-con-qtranslate-x-traduciendo-widgets.html
- Multiidiomas en WordPress con qTranslate X - Añade un selector de idioma en el Menú - https://www.webempresa.com/blog/item/1831-multiidiomas-en-wordpress-con-qtranslate-x-anade-un-selector-de-idioma-en-el-menu.html
- Multiidiomas en WordPress con qTranslate X - Redirección del idioma - https://www.webempresa.com/blog/item/1838-multiidiomas-en-wordpress-con-qtranslate-x-redireccion-del-idioma.html
Revisa si con esta alternativa sigues teniendo problemas para traducir la web.
No obstante, deberías contactar con los compañeros del Soporte Técnico para que verifiquen si a nivel de servidor hay algún fallo como memoria de Suhosin etc. y esté ocasionando esos errores.
Saludos
Ok. Gracias, voy a probar con lo que me dices.
Saludos.
Hola, los compañeros del Soporte Técnico me han solucionado un problema, pero ahora me aparece el siguiente error:
[03-Aug-2015 19:33:40 UTC] PHP Fatal error: Class 'Gantry_ICL_Language_Switcher' not found in /home/aldezaha/public_html/wp-includes/widgets.php on line 560
Saludos.
Hola
Ese error es reciente?, al parecer esta relacionado con algún widget, prueba quitando los widgets relacionados con idiomas
Desde soporte supongo que te han restaurado alguna copia
Saludos.
Hola, estoy intentando seguir los pasos indicados por Rafael, y he instalado el plugin qTranslate X y W2Q: WPML to qTranslate. Este último plugin me da el siguiente error:
Parse error: syntax error, unexpected '[' in /home/aldezaha/public_html/wp-content/plugins/w2q-wpml-to-qtranslate/w2q-wpml-to-qtranslate.php on line 261
Lo he instalado manualmente por Filezilla y automáticamente por wordpress, y me da el mismo error.
No sé si hay otra manera de migrar los datos de WPML a qtranslateX, o si es un error que se puede solucionar.
Gracias.
Hola Nagore,
https://wordpress.org/support/topic/error-on-line-261-unexpected
Veo que aparte del cambio en el código, indican un posible motivo del error:
It's probably because you use an older version of PHP
Envía un ticket al departamento de hosting y dominios para que te indiquen la versión de PHP que tienes en tu cuenta de hosting, y si es una versión antigua, por ejemplo PHP 5.3, pues que suban a PHP 5.4 o PHP 5.5
Saludos